User Participation Driven Map Sharing Platform Based On GeoRSS

As the transition phase from GISystem to GIService,for reason of the compatibility of spatial data format,the original spatial information sharing based on data transformation caused data distribution and data sharing difficultly.However,the emergence of GIService has changed the way of data distribution in which to solve the problem of the compatibility of spatial data format.GIService which is published by wrapping spatial information as services shares spatial information between client and server.However,there are some limitations for GIService which is too specialized,because GIService is program-oriented,or developer-oriented,so that can't be directly use by users.Therefore,the client program is necessary,but existing clients are too professional to hardly operate and share.Therefore,a public-oriented spatial information sharing must be easy to use,mainly manifested in the following areas:uniform data format,easy to disseminate data,user-friendly user interface,easy to operate,and easy to share map.In the approach to public-oriented spatial information sharing,the spatial information is created by the users instead of exiting by default,so the users played a significant role in this platform.Users create maps as well as add spatial information to the platform,and there are interdependent between user and platform.The more users are,the more spatial information is created,so that the spatial information in platform from users sharing will be growing.Therefore,this paper presents an approach to user participation spatial information sharing,which is based on the following two points:easy to operate and easy to share.This paper presents user participation driven spatial data sharing which is facing public comparing with GIService-based spatial data sharing.This approach recommends users themselves creating maps which are collected into the platform and acquired by everyone.As a content provider as well as a content consumer,user adheres to other tightly.User participation driven spatial information sharing is a big leap in spatial information sharing under Web2.0 environment,because not only to resolve the spatial information sharing,but also changed the pattern of spatial data collection.This paper establishes a GeoRSS-based spatial data model that resolving the compatibility of spatial data formats and avoiding complicated operation.The purpose of spatial data model is to operate the data easily for users,because it's important to standardize all kinds of spatial data format,and then publish a standard service.Comparing with other spatial data formats such as Shapefile,RSS,KML and GeoJSON,GeoRSS is chosen as a central data format,and is used to be subscribed by other clients or servers.Spatial data model is separated by 3 models which are data input-output model,data save model and data presentation model.This paper established a RESTful website based on Resource-Oriented Architecture that users can share map easily because each resource is identifiable and only has one corresponding URI.According to REST principle and platform functional design,platform is divided into resources each of which has a corresponding controller which implements one functional module and should be authorized so that not everyone can acquire the resource.
